DMP files 5,337 cases over traffic irregularities

Traffic Division of the Dhaka Metropolitan Police (DMP) in their simultaneous drives on the city streets on Friday filed 5,337 cases against different modes of vehicles for violating traffic rules, reports BSS. Police at the time fined the traffic offenders Taka 22, 60,400 and sent 12 vehicles to dumping ground. Apart from this, a total of 572 vehicles were sent for wrecking.

A total of 125 vehicles were sued for using hydraulic horns, six vehicles for using hooters and beacon lights, 727 vehicles for moving into the wrong way and 12 microbuses were booked for using black glasses on windows, said a DMP press release today. Cases were also filed against 1,534 motorcycles for violating traffic rules and 133 more were seized. A total of 154 drivers were also booked for talking on mobile phones while driving, added the DMP press release.
